The Creation of Lab Grown Diamonds

Lab grown diamonds are created using advanced technological processes that replicate the natural diamond growing conditions. The two primary methods are:

  1. High Pressure-High Temperature (HPHT): This method mimics the natural conditions in the Earth’s mantle. A small diamond seed is placed in carbon and exposed to high pressure and high temperature, causing the carbon to melt and form a diamond around the seed.
  2. Chemical Vapor Deposition (CVD): In the CVD process, a diamond seed is placed in a chamber filled with carbon-rich gases. These gases are heated, causing the carbon atoms to precipitate onto the diamond seed, gradually building up a diamond.

Characteristics of Lab Grown Diamonds

Lab grown diamonds possess the same physical, chemical, and optical properties as mined diamonds. They exhibit the same hardness, refractive index, and sparkle. The key difference lies in their origin – one comes from the Earth, while the other from a lab.

The Appeal of Lab Diamonds

The growing popularity of man made diamonds stems from several factors:

  1. Sustainability: Lab diamonds offer a more environmentally friendly alternative to traditional mining. Their production requires less mining and soil displacement, making them a favorite among eco-conscious consumers.
  2. Ethical Assurance: Consumers concerned about the ethical implications of mining can rest assured with lab grown diamonds, as they are free from the conflicts often associated with diamond mining.
  3. Affordability: Typically, lab diamonds are more affordable than their mined counterparts. This price difference allows buyers to access larger or higher quality diamonds within the same budget.
  4. Quality and Variety: Lab grown diamonds offer a wide range of sizes, shapes, and colors, providing buyers with a plethora of choices to meet their specific preferences.
